Warning Signs You Need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ration

Water damage can be a costly and time-consuming problem if not addressed quickly. Here are some warning signs that you need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ration services: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ty odor in your warehouse that won’t go away, it could be a sign of water damage. This type of odor is often caused by mold and mildew growth, which can be hazardous to your health.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. This type of damage can be caused by standing water or excessive moisture in the air.

Discoloration or Staining on Walls or Ceilings

Discoloration or staining on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. This type of damage can be caused by leaks or water seepage through cracks in the walls or ceiling.

Warehouse Water Damage Restoration Cost in Arbutus, MD

The cost of Warehouse Water Damage Restoration in Arbutus, MD,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ved in restoring your warehouse. Here’s a general breakdown of the costs you can exp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Cleaning and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Restoration and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Specialized equipment rental $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Technician labor costs $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
